What is a Quick Reference Guide? A quick reference guide is a document that provides a concise overview of the most important rules, spells, and character options in Dungeons and Dragons 5e. It's usually a one-page document that can be printed out and kept at the table for easy reference. A good quick reference guide should include information on character creation, spellcasting, combat, and exploration, as well as any other essential rules and options.
